White Chocolate Popcorn Substitutions

I know what it’s like when you don’t have everything on hand, and the last thing you want to do is run to the store and pick something up. Here are a few ideas to substitute items on the ingredients list if needed:

  1. There are different brands of white candy melts you can use. I would just follow the instructions on the back of the package for melting. I like using Ghirardelli’s White Vanilla Flavored Wafers. Melted white chocolate chips could work too, or almond bark, but I haven’t recipe tested with those.
  2. I just use whatever buttered popcorn we have at home. If you don’t want the butter and salt, you can make your own popcorn or buy the popcorn flavor you like best.
  3. Any sprinkles work. This popcorn could be made for any holiday, so I would choose a sprinkle mix you like best for the holiday you are celebrating.
  4. I used one drop of Wilton’s Magenta gel food coloring. For a Valentine’s Day Mix, you could use red food dye, another pink gel color, or purple, or red. It mixes with the white and will be lighter. For a different holiday, choose the color of choice. You can also do all of it with just white without the dye/gel color.
  5. The M&M’s Cupid mix is so fun in this mix. You could do peanut M&Ms, or a different variety, and of course different colors for different holidays.

Step-by-step Instructions

Step 1. Pop the popcorn in the microwave according to package directions and pour it into a large bowl. Divide the wafers into two small microwaveable bowls. Melt one bowl of the wafers according to package directions. Make sure to stir well after heating the wafers in 15-second intervals until completely melted. Pour 1/2 cup of the M&Ms into the popcorn. Pour the melted chocolate over the popcorn M&M mix and stir to coat. Pour onto the prepared baking sheet in a single layer.

Step 2. Melt the second bowl of wafers according to package directions. Add 1-3 drops of food gel coloring and stir well until no more white is visible. Use a spoon to dip into the melted chocolate and drizzle the tinted chocolate over the popcorn. Immediately sprinkle over the popcorn the sprinkles and the remaining half cup of M&Ms. Let sit for 15-20 minutes for the white chocolate to set and serve.

Tips

  • This is a flexible recipe that can be made for any holiday using different colored M&Ms, sprinkles, and a different gel or food dye color to tint the white chocolate.
  • Lining the sheet pan with parchment paper is a big help with cleanup, and I highly recommend it.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the white chocolate popcorn be made in advance?
Popped popcorn is best the day it is made, but it can last about a week in a sealed container. It will lose its best crispness, however, within a few days. As the popcorn is so easy and fast to make, I suggest making this mix the day you serve it, or the day before if necessary.
How do I store white chocolate popcorn?
a. Store the popcorn mix in an air-tight container for up to a week. I use a Tupperware container.
b. Popcorn freezes really well and can be stored in an air-tight container or Ziplog bag for up to a month. Some people say it tastes better frozen, and even tastes more salty and doesn’t stick in your mouth as much. I need to taste test this myself.

Ingredients

  • One 3.29-ounce bag of unpopped buttered popcorn

  • 10 ounces white vanilla flavored melting wafers (I used Ghirardelli’s)

  • 1 cup M&Ms, divided (I used the 10-ounce Milk Chocolate Cupid Mix Valentine’s Day Candy Bag)

  • 3 tablespoons Valentine’s Day themed sprinkles (I used the hearts and dots in Wilton’s Sprinkles Mix with Valentine’s colors)

  • 1 -3 drops pink gel food coloring (I used one drop of Wilton’s Magenta gel food coloring)

Directions

  •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
  • Pop the popcorn in the microwave according to package directions and pour it into a large bowl.
  • Divide the wafers into two small microwaveable bowls. Melt one bowl of the wafers according to package directions. Make sure to stir well after heating the wafers in 15-second intervals until completely melted.
  • Pour 1/2 cup of the M&Ms into the popcorn. Pour the melted chocolate over the popcorn M&M mix and stir with a spatula to coat. Pour onto the prepared baking sheet in a single layer.
  • Melt the second bowl of wafers according to package directions. Add 1-3 drops of food gel coloring and stir well until no more white is visible. Use a spoon to dip into the melted chocolate and drizzle the tinted chocolate over the popcorn. Immediately sprinkle over the popcorn the sprinkles and the remaining half cup of M&Ms.
  • Let it sit for at least 20 minutes for the white chocolate to set and serve.

Notes

  • I used one drop of Wilton’s Magenta gel food coloring. For a Valentine’s Day Mix, you could use red food dye, another pink gel color, or purple, or red. It mixes with the white and will be lighter. You can also do all of it without the dye/gel color to keep it white.
  • I just use whatever buttered popcorn we have at home. If you don’t want the butter and salt, you can make your own popcorn or buy the popcorn flavor you like best.
  • After the white chocolate sets on the popcorn, the popcorn will be a little stiff. If you are putting it in a container for serving, you will need to break it a little into chunks to fit your container, or serve from the sheet pan if desired.
